Cowgirl Track Competes In Norman This Week
May 06, 2009 | Cowgirl Cross Country & Track
May 6, 2009
STILLWATER, Okla. - Six members of the Oklahoma State women's track and field team will head to Norman, Okla., Saturday to compete in the Sooner Twilight, held at the University of Oklahoma's John Jacobs Track and Field Complex.
With only one weekend of competition remaining before the Big 12 Outdoor Championships in Lubbock, Texas, the meet serves as a chance for several Cowgirls to hit NCAA regional qualifying marks before the season ends.
Clarissa Andrews is the lone Cowgirl competing in both the triple and long jumps. Andrews has leapt 5.82 meters in the long jump twice this season, but has yet to hit the regional mark of 6.00 meters. She also jumped a personal-best 12.49 meters in the triple jump earlier this season, easily beating the regional mark of 12.32 meters, but the jump did not count toward regional qualification due to the wind speed.
The other five Cowgirls will compete on the track, including Kristen Gillespie and Brandi Andrews in the 800 meters, Teran Mixon and Courtney Schultz in the 1,500 meters and Kendra Woodson in the 400-meter hurdles. All five athletes have come within seconds of regional qualification in their respective events, but none have hit the mark.
The Sooner Twilight is scheduled to begin at 10 a.m. with the javelin throw and conclude with the 4x400-meter relay at 4:55 p.m.
